It would make all the business sense in the world for Elden Ring publisher Bandai Namco to capitalise on the success of its property outside the realm of video games. This is why we’ve seen tons of merchandise, tabletop board games and much more.

Furthermore, Elden Ring even has its manga series Elden Ring: The Road to the Erdtree as well as a web series, Elden Ring Become Lord. Now, fans can look forward to another manga inspired by the Lands Between but it might not be what you expect.

As reported by Comicbook.com, Elden Ring: Going Forward, There Will Be Our Bond tells the tale of two streamers in love with the FromSoftware action RPG. This new manga series will be published by Kadokawa and it will be available from 30 May 2024.



“A teenage school boy is spending his days playing video games, especially PvP, where he thrives & shares his sessions via live streaming,” reads the synopsis of Elden Ring: Going Forward, There Will Be Our Bond. “But one day out of the blue his classmate shares his struggles playing “Elden Ring” & the boy is impulsively stepping in to help him out.”

“Soon he enjoys their joint gaming sessions, but it gradually changes the content of his live streams, causing tension with his viewers. This is the youth tale of a high school gamer trying to balance his online presence with real-world friendships.”

Hopefully, we’ll eventually see Elden Ring: Going Forward, There Will Be Our Bond stocked in many comic book retail stores worldwide. As for the upcoming expansion, Shadow of the Erdtree will be released on 21 June 2024 for PC, PlayStation and Xbox.
